Rumor is a product and venture studio based in Vancouver that designs and builds software for startups through enterprise-stage companies. The company operates two parallel lines: a services arm handling product development, design, and go-to-market strategy across sectors including workforce management, ERP/CRM, eCommerce, and mobility; and a venture arm that acquires and scales its own tech companies. The team of 11–50 spans engineering, product, design, and support, with active hiring across Mexico, India, France, and Italy. Current work includes a logistics platform with freight forwarder and airline integrations, a healthcare SaaS product, and rapid prototyping of AI-driven tools.
Frontend: Next.js, React, TypeScript, Tailwind CSS, Webflow, Framer. Backend: Node.js, Express, PostgreSQL, Redis. Infrastructure: Azure, Docker, Kubernetes, Azure DevOps, GitHub Actions. Design: Figma. Communication: Slack, Dialpad, RingCentral. Also uses Shopify and Unbounce for client projects.
